#26806c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#26806c is composed of 14.9% red, 50.2%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.6%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 166.7 degrees, a saturation of 54.2% and a lightness of 32.5%. #26806c color hex could be obtained by blending #4cffd8 with #000100.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#26806c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020706 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#26806c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535353 is the less saturated color, while #06a07e is the most saturated one.
